Serum Amyloid A and Haptoglobin as Markers in Cats with Gingivitis-Preliminary Study.

Background: Chronic gingivostomatitis has been associated with increases in α1-acid glycoprotein and serum haptoglobin (Hp) in cats. However, serum amyloid A (SAA) and Hp have not been previously evaluated in cats with uncomplicated gingivitis.

Objectives: To compare SAA and Hp between cats with gingivitis and healthy cats, and to investigate the correlation between these two proteins and the severity of gingivitis.

Methods: This was a prospective cross-sectional study. Adult, FIV- and FeLV-seronegative cats were included. The cats were allocated into two age- and sex-matched groups. The case group included cats with gingivitis, and the control group included clinically and clinicopathologically healthy cats. The severity of gingivitis was assessed by the Total Mouth Periodontal Score (TMPS)-G index. Serum samples were used to measure SAA and Hp using a previously validated turbidimetric immunoassay and haemoglobin-binding method, respectively. The R statistical language was used for the statistical analysis.

Results: A total of 22 cats were included, 11 in each study group. The median (range) age of cats was 5.0 (3.0-11.0) years. The median Hp concentration was significantly higher (p = 0.001) in the case group (2.40 [0.72-4.44] g/L) compared with the control group (1.06 [0.50-1.42] g/L). A significant correlation was found between Hp and TMPS-G (rho = 0.636, p = 0.040). The SAA was below the detection limit (0.4 mg/L) in all samples of the control group and in 10/11 samples of the case group.

Conclusions: Feline gingivitis is associated with increased Hp, suggesting the presence of an acute-phase reaction. Haptoglobin appears to be correlated with the severity of the disease.

期刊介绍: Veterinary Medicine and Science is the peer-reviewed journal for rapid dissemination of research in all areas of veterinary medicine and science. The journal aims to serve the research community by providing a vehicle for authors wishing to publish interesting and high quality work in both fundamental and clinical veterinary medicine and science. Veterinary Medicine and Science publishes original research articles, systematic reviews, meta-analyses, and research methods papers, along with invited editorials and commentaries. Original research papers must report well-conducted research with conclusions supported by the data presented in the paper. We aim to be a truly global forum for high-quality research in veterinary medicine and science, and believe that the best research should be published and made widely accessible as quickly as possible. Veterinary Medicine and Science publishes papers submitted directly to the journal and those referred from a select group of prestigious journals published by Wiley-Blackwell. Veterinary Medicine and Science is a Wiley Open Access journal, one of a new series of peer-reviewed titles publishing quality research with speed and efficiency.
